Greece's Alexis Tsipras loses election

The leftist party Syriza has lost the snap election called by the Greek Prime Minister AlexisTsipras. We have reaction from one of his former advisers. Five years into the war in Yemen, millions of people are short of food and many now face another cholera outbreak. We speak to Save the Children in Hodeida. And Bosco Ntaganda awaits a verdict at the International Criminal Court in The Hague on charges of war crimes in the Democratic Republic of Congo. He denies all charges.
